UPS launches next-day service from Hong Kong to Europe

UPS has launched direct flights from Hong Kong to Europe, enabling the company to offer the widest next-day delivery coverage for both packages and heavy freight between the two regions.
 

With the addition of four direct flights, UPS now offers a total of eleven flights from Hong Kong to Europe each week.

The new daily direct B747-400 flights will link Hong Kong with Cologne in Germany. Operating Monday to Thursday, the new flights are in addition to the seven flights UPS already offers each week between Hong Kong and Cologne via Dubai.

The new service offers wide coverage across Europe, reaching 34 countries with non-dutiable small package and letters service, and 18 countries with dutiable small package service.

With the UPS express freight service, shipments can be delivered in one day to 18 countries and 39 cities across Europe, including Paris, Milan, Prague, Frankfurt, Madrid, Barcelona and Copenhagen.

UPS’s Cologne air hub is the centrepiece of the company’s extensive and integrated European air and ground network, which includes 460 operating facilities and 156 daily intra-Europe flight segments.

"The new direct flights significantly reduce the transit time between Hong Kong and Europe, providing European businesses that import from Asia a faster and more efficient option," said Wolfgang Flick, president of UPS Europe.  "Over the last few years, Hong Kong to Europe has become one of the fastest growing trade lanes.  UPS’s new flights add significant capacity to support this lane."
